The Polkadot-based Astar Community not too long ago announced the primary web3 and blockchain hackathon sponsored by the Japanese Toyota Motor Company. HAKUHODO KEY3 firm, co-founded by Astar and HAKUHODO, one in all Japan’s largest promoting corporations, will host the web3 hackathon on February 25 this yr.
The Astar Basis will sponsor the occasion with $75,000 and the web3 basis with $25,000. In accordance with a press launch, the $100k will likely be used as a reward for successful initiatives chosen by Toyota, Astar Basis, web3 Basis, Alchemy, and HAKUHODO KEY3.

Sota Watanabe, CEO of Stake Applied sciences, made the announcement. Watanabe acknowledged that lately, corporations have been dealing with the problem of accelerating the workload on managers attributable to elevated enterprise decision-making and group member administration. Subsequently, The Astar Basis and the Polkadot-based Astar Community determined to develop a DAO assist software for corporations.
DAO is the abbreviation for “Decentralized Autonomous Group.” By setting guidelines by means of good contracts on the blockchain, the organizations and firms like Toyota could be managed and operated “transparently.”
As well as, Watanabe mentioned that primarily based on Astar Community convictions, if the corporate can handle initiatives as DAO, organizations like Toyota, during which group members can function autonomously and with decision-making distributed, can cut back the supervisor’s workload and, on the identical time, assist with group members influence within the firm’s development.
Toyota, the biggest automotive firm on the planet when it comes to offered vehicles, has over 330,00 staff throughout the globe. Within the hackathon, Astar is looking for DAO instruments to implement within the automotive producer to enhance its workflow and operations.

Overview Of The Use Of Blockchain By Astar Community
Astar goals to develop into the go-to blockchain mission in Japan. Thus, they established an organization known as Startale Labs. Astar claims it’s dedicated to additional selling web3 within the Asian nation.
The federal government enterprises in Japan and web3 options are working with Astar to deliver collectively a world platform to speed up and create blockchain-based options for a number of use circumstances. Astar’s ecosystem has develop into Polkadot’s main Parachain globally.
Astar gives the flexibleness for all Ethereum and WebAssembly instruments, a binary instruction format for a stack-based digital machine (WASM) for builders to begin constructing their decentralized purposes (dApps). Astar gives an Incubation Hub for groups of all backgrounds and focuses, used to speed up development on Polkadot and its experimental blockchain, the Kusama Community.
